Two Choices

We are graced to see days
As liberals with a choice of ways
To strike it rich
Just to keep ourselves out of reach
Or to earn honor among brethren
Inheritable by our children

For our way of life will earn
The future we would loath or yearn
For in us, the power abounds
To cause our desired turnarounds
Build up brick by brick
And thread by thread yarn the fabric

All ways lead towards
But choose that that leads to best regards
Trusting in values and moral stands
And not in fortunes that change hands
And be in that place of rest
Where a sound mind is at its best
